Class Information
Number: 313/605
Name: Electric lamp and discharge devices > With gas or vapor > Mean free-path spacing of envelope portions or content parts
Description: Subject matter wherein one envelope portion or a part of the device is spaced from another envelope portion or part of the device a distance which is less than the mean free-path length distance.
